Inside the Public Investigation Office

Inside the interrogation room, a sharp light beamed down from a large steam lamp hanging above the table. The light was directed straight at the broad face of Inspector Edward Graves, while the rest of the room was swallowed in darkness.

Graves sat on the chair, his back straight and his hands on the table. His face was stiff, showing no trace of tension. Directly across from him sat Inspector Cornelius Wright.

Cornelius slammed the table violently, shaking the few papers scattered on top.

"Why don't you confess, Edward, and end this? I'll make sure you get a lighter sentence."

Graves raised his eyes toward him, his expression steady and his voice calm.

"Confess to what? I did nothing."

Cornelius smirked sarcastically, then pulled from his bag a sword hilt without a blade, decorated with small engravings, and placed it in front of Graves before saying:

"Do you know what this is?"
